From 3d0f60a63e36969e731c6f2375b96c900769d861 Mon Sep 17 00:00:00 2001 From: Ivailo Monev Date: Mon, 3 Oct 2022 13:46:20 +0300 Subject: [PATCH] okular: merge OkularConfigureChecks.cmake into main CMKaeLists.txt file Signed-off-by: Ivailo Monev --- okular/CMakeLists.txt | 14 ++++++++++++-- okular/OkularConfigureChecks.cmake | 18 ------------------ 2 files changed, 12 insertions(+), 20 deletions(-) delete mode 100644 okular/OkularConfigureChecks.cmake diff --git a/okular/CMakeLists.txt b/okular/CMakeLists.txt index 787c256d..1f94b1ae 100644 --- a/okular/CMakeLists.txt +++ b/okular/CMakeLists.txt @@ -67,6 +67,18 @@ add_feature_info(okular_kpsewhich "DVI support in Okular" ) +option( + OKULAR_FORCE_DRM + "Forces okular to check for DRM to decide if you can copy/print protected pdf. (default=no)" + OFF +) +kde4_bool_to_01(OKULAR_FORCE_DRM _OKULAR_FORCE_DRM) + +configure_file( + ${CMAKE_CURRENT_SOURCE_DIR}/config-okular.h.cmake + ${CMAKE_CURRENT_BINARY_DIR}/config-okular.h +) + add_subdirectory( ui ) add_subdirectory( shell ) add_subdirectory( generators ) @@ -75,8 +87,6 @@ if(ENABLE_TESTING) add_subdirectory( tests ) endif() -include(OkularConfigureChecks.cmake) - set(MATH_LIB m) # okularcore diff --git a/okular/OkularConfigureChecks.cmake b/okular/OkularConfigureChecks.cmake deleted file mode 100644 index 70fe8768..00000000 --- a/okular/OkularConfigureChecks.cmake +++ /dev/null @@ -1,18 +0,0 @@ - -option( - OKULAR_FORCE_DRM - "Forces okular to check for DRM to decide if you can copy/print protected pdf. (default=no)" - OFF -) -if (OKULAR_FORCE_DRM) - set(_OKULAR_FORCE_DRM 1) -else (OKULAR_FORCE_DRM) - set(_OKULAR_FORCE_DRM 0) -endif (OKULAR_FORCE_DRM) - -# at the end, output the configuration -configure_file( - ${CMAKE_CURRENT_SOURCE_DIR}/config-okular.h.cmake - ${CMAKE_CURRENT_BINARY_DIR}/config-okular.h -) - -- 2.11.0